Output 80d950ec556d7f40ec4bae0093a7fb3e484d015a99e8235adc312f2774c6883a:89

value
1306
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 6de658f5201cdaa5e6aff948117cdf1ad143bc3363fc7c12f49fddcef9cc60b0
address
bc1pdhn93afqrnd2te40l9ypzlxlrtg580pnv078cyh5nlwua7wvvzcqu36z0h
transaction
80d950ec556d7f40ec4bae0093a7fb3e484d015a99e8235adc312f2774c6883a
spent
true